Árvore de páginas

01. DATOS GENERALES


Producto

TOTVS Backoffice

Línea de producto: 

Línea Protheus

Segmento:

Backoffice

Módulo:SIGAFIN - Financiero.
Función:
RutinaNombre Técnico

FINA086.PRW

Anulación de Orden de Pago.

País:Argentina.
Ticket:N/A.
Requisito/Story/Issue (informe el requisito vinculado):DMICNS-18389.


02. SITUACIÓN/REQUISITO

Al ingresar a la rutina de orden de pago con una fecha anterior a la configurada en el parámetro MV_DATAFIN, el sistema permite la exclusión de ordenes de pago, lo cual es incorrecto ya que el sistema no debe permitir realizar exclusiones de ordenes de pago si la fecha del sistema no es mayor o igual a la fecha configurada en el parámetro MV_DATAFIN.


03. SOLUCIÓN

En la rutina de anulación de orden de pago (FINA086), en las funciones FINA086 Y FA086MBROW, se da tratamiento para validar cuando la fecha del sistema o la fecha de emisión de la orden de pago es menor a la configurada en el parámetro MV_DATAFIN, en caso de ser menor, aparecerá el mensaje “No se permiten entrar movimientos financieros con fechas menores que la fecha límite de movimientos en el Financiero”, en caso de ser mayor la fecha, permitirá la anulación de ordenes de pago.



Por medio del módulo de Configurador (SIGACFG) realizar la configuración de los parámetros correspondientes:

  • MV_DATAFIN = 20231020 - Fecha limite para la ejecución de las operaciones financieras.

  1. En la rutina de Productos (MATA010) que se encuentra en el menú perteneciente al módulo Financiero (Actualizaciones | Archivos) registre un producto.

  2. En la rutina de Bancos (MATA070) que se encuentra en el menú perteneciente al módulo Financiero (Actualizaciones | Archivos) registre un banco.

  3. En la rutina de Cuentas Por Pagar (FINA050) que se encuentra en el menú perteneciente al módulo Financiero (Actualizaciones | Cuentas Por Pagar) genere cuentas por pagar.

  4. En la rutina de Orden Pago Modelo II (FINA847) que se encuentra en el menú perteneciente al módulo Financiero (Actualizaciones | Proceso Mod II) genere ordenes de pago en diferentes días.

    1. OP-1 con fecha  
    2. OP-2 con fecha  
    3. OP-3 con fecha  

Por medio del módulo de Configurador (SIGACFG) realizar la configuración de los parámetros correspondientes:

  • MV_DATAFIN = 20231030 - Fecha limite para la ejecución de las operaciones financieras.

  1. A través de la rutina de Orden Pago Modelo II (FINA847) que se encuentra en el menú perteneciente al módulo Financiero (Actualizaciones | Proceso Mod II) ingrese con fecha del 25/10/2023 seleccione el botón Otras acciones, después seleccione la opción Anular Ord. Pago.

    1. El sistema no debe permitir mostrar ninguna orden de pago ya que la fecha del sistema es inferior a la configurada en el parámetro MV_DATAFIN. En este caso debe aparecer el siguiente mensaje: "No se permiten entrar movimientos financieros con fechas menores que la fecha límite de movimientos en el Financiero".

Por medio del módulo de Configurador (SIGACFG) realizar la configuración de los parámetros correspondientes:

  • MV_DATAFIN = 20231027 - Fecha limite para la ejecución de las operaciones financieras.

  1. A través de la rutina de Orden Pago Modelo II (FINA847) que se encuentra en el menú perteneciente al módulo Financiero (Actualizaciones | Proceso Mod II) ingrese con fecha del 27/10/2023 seleccione el botón Otras acciones, después seleccione la opción Anular Ord. Pago.

    1. El sistema debe permitir informar los parámetros para la consulta de ordenes de pago a anular.

    2. Seleccione la primer orden de pago con fecha del 25/10/2023.

      1. El sistema no debe permitir la selección de esta orden de pago, debe aparecer el siguiente mensaje: "No se permiten entrar movimientos financieros con fechas menores que la fecha límite de movimientos en el Financiero".
    3. Seleccione las demás ordenes de pago que poseen fecha del 27/10/2023 y 30/10/2023.
    4. El sistema debe permitir la selección de estas ordenes de pago, de clic al botón Confirmar, después verifique que las ordenes de pago anuladas aparezca con la leyenda roja como ordenes de pago anuladas.


04. INFORMACIÓN ADICIONAL

No aplica.


05. ASUNTOS RELACIONADOS

  • No aplica.